The Role
The Quality Supervisor leads in-process quality assurance across injection molding, foaming, wrapping, and assembly. This role focuses on preventing defects at the source, driving continuous improvement, and ensuring robust process controls meet IATF 16949 and internal standards.
Key Responsibilities
- In-Process Management: Supervise daily quality activities and ensure strict adherence to control plans, PFMEAs, and standard operating procedures.
- Auditing & Compliance: Conduct regular process, layered (LPA), and product audits. Monitor real time KPIs to prevent non conforming products from advancing.
- Problem Solving: Lead root cause analysis using 8D, 5 Why, and Ishikawa methods. Drive projects to reduce scrap, rework, and process variation.
- Team Leadership: Coach and develop a team of Inspectors, Engineers, and Lab Technicians. Establish performance goals and lead technical training.
- Cross-Functional Support: Collaborate with Production, Engineering, and Maintenance to resolve issues. Support NPI and PPAP activities from a quality perspective.
